Eagle Proprietary Investments, the Dubai-based financial investment arm of National Industries Group (NIG), has acquired Sri Lankan stock brokerage firm Heraymila Securities and asset management firm Heraymila Capital.
According to a media statement, the companies will be rebranded as Candor Equities and Candor Asset Management.
"The strategic acquisition will give Middle Eastern investors greater access to Sri Lankan capital markets and financial advisory services, while bringing international management expertise to a highly respected local firm," said the statement.
Under the terms of the deal, Eagle Proprietary Investments has acquired four licenses to operate in Sri Lanka, covering equity capital market brokerage, asset management, financial advisory, and outsourcing.
Raj Dvivedi, CEO of Eagle Proprietary Investments, said that Sri Lanka has come within the radar of foreign direct investment inflows as the country’s political situation has normalized markedly in recent years.
"Being situated at the centre of global trade routes, the country’s capital markets have immense potential for growth," he added.
The new management of Candor Equities will comprise of members of the former Heraymila Securities and directors from the financial industry.
